A glimpse at how Garland's electrical problem fits together
Garland beings in a pocket of North Texas where summer warmth chefs attic rooms to 140 levels and springtime tornados toss tree limbs right into service drops. The clay soil swells, foundations shift, and gradually avenue and underground feeders feel that activity. Much of our utility power in the city is given by Garland Power & & Light, with some fringe areas served by Oncor. That indicates meter pulls, service upgrades, and blackout sychronisation need to be handled with the appropriate utility partner and within city permitting rules.

On the property side, areas built in various years tell various electrical stories. Sixties and seventies homes often have light weight aluminum branch-circuit electrical wiring that demands unique adapters. Older cottages might still have two-wire receptacles without a ground. Newer class frequently have combination arc-fault breakers and tamper-resistant receptacles, which lower annoyance tripping when mounted appropriately, and trigger disappointment when they are not.

Commercial rooms include intricacy. Dining establishments require committed circuits for refrigeration and cook lines, roof units call for proper disconnects, and tenant build-outs in strip facilities need to pass strategy testimonial with lots estimations and allow examinations. When a task touches the service tools, the utility needs to be set up to kill power and reconnect. That control is routine for a neighborhood electrician in Garland and a mess for any individual attempting to wing it.
What licensing acquires you in Texas, and why it matters in Garland
In Texas, electrical experts are licensed by the Texas Division of Licensing and Policy. Firms bring a Texas Electric Service provider permit, frequently noted as a TECL number. A master electrician is the accountable celebration on that particular certificate, and the specialists in the area bring their own licenses as journeymen, property wiremen, or pupils. That structure is not just documents. It sets the flooring for training hours, code understanding, and insurance.

Garland's Building Inspection division implements the National Electrical Code with local amendments. A qualified electrician in Garland draws permits, timetables evaluations, and files work in a way the city acknowledges. When you sell your residence or renew a commercial lease, that paper trail issues. I have watched a home sale delay due to the fact that a purchaser's examiner found bootlegged grounds and a service pole taped together with electric tape. The seller paid twice: once for the unpermitted job, once more to have it dealt with and checked under a deadline.

Insurance protection is another silent safeguard. Most trustworthy electric services Garland companies lug basic obligation and workers' compensation. If a ladder slides on your driveway and a panel gets dented, you are not fighting with a handyman's texting app to obtain it squared away. You are dealing with a business that has a license to protect and a policy to back it.
The false economic situation of do it yourself and unlicensed work
I respect capable house owners and functional local business owner. Replacing a light or switching a poor switch with the breaker off, sure. But troubleshooting a shared neutral in a multiwire branch circuit, computing conductor fill in a jampacked avenue, or landing light weight aluminum conductors with the appropriate antioxidant paste is not a YouTube weekend.

I once mapped reoccuring flicker in a North Garland cattle ranch back to a loose neutral at the weatherhead. The home owners had changed 3 lighting fixtures and a dimmer attempting to resolve it. By the time we discovered the genuine problem, sensitive electronics had taken duplicated voltage swings. A refrigerator control board and an office UPS had already stopped working. The solution at the pole and meter can was uncomplicated, yet the history damages transformed a tiny issue into a four-figure week.

Commercial areas elevate the stakes. A dining establishment on Belt Line called after a small shock at the prep sink. The offender was a piece of unbonded stainless tied to tools that had been moved during a DIY over night reconfiguration. We remedied the bonding, added a GFCI where somebody had bypassed security, and passed a same-day evaluation. The owner had actually saved a couple of hundred till that moment. A customer occurrence would have set you back greatly more.

Real numbers: what job in fact costs in North Texas
No two tasks are specifically alike, but the arrays listed below mirror what I see for usual job across Garland. Prices move with copper expenses and labor demand, and gain access to can push a work up or down.

Service panel upgrades to 200 amps in a regular single-family home typically land in between 2,500 and 5,500. Aspects include meter area, mast condition, grounding, arc-fault and GFCI breaker demands, and whether stucco or block needs repair.

Level 2 EV charger circuits usually run 600 to 1,500 for an uncomplicated 50 amp run, even more if the panel is complete or the range is long.

Whole home rise defense expenses 250 to 800 relying on the device and whether we are opening up a congested panel.

Ceiling fans and light fixtures run 150 to 300 per location when the box is ranked and the switch remains in location. If we are fishing brand-new wire with insulated outside walls or cutting drywall, anticipate more.

Troubleshooting normally starts with a first hour between 125 and 200, after that 100 to 150 each extra hour. Good troubleshooting conserves money by finding the origin, not by competing the clock.

Commercial work scales quickly. A little solution upgrade in a retail bay can run 8,000 to 20,000 when you element equipment lead times, utility coordination, and closures. Kitchen build-outs climb from there with hood controls, emergency situation egress lighting, and devoted refrigeration circuits.

A last point on cost. The most affordable number in your inbox usually has missing line things. Ask what licenses, patching, and energy charges are consisted of. A truthful residential electrician in Garland will tell you where the unknowns are and exactly how they intend to manage them.
The hard troubles we see often in Garland homes
Certain issues repeat throughout the city. Resolving them the right way shields your tools and your insurance policy coverage.

Aluminum branch circuits from the sixties and very early seventies appear in parts of North Garland. The repair is not to smear paste and hope. The approved repairs entail authorized connectors such as AlumiConn or COPALUM crimps, gadget modifications to CO/ALR where suitable, and cautious torque. This is not cosmetic job. Done poorly, you get warmth at the connection and eventually a failing in a box concealed by drywall.

Two-wire receptacle systems without a ground prevail in older homes. You can not just exchange to a three-prong and call it good. The code enables an appropriately classified GFCI instead of a ground, but that still needs correct electrical wiring and labeling. I have found bootlegged premises connected to neutrals at receptacles, which defeats safety tools and creates shock dangers. A qualified electrician in Garland understands when to recommend a partial rewire versus a careful GFCI plan that meets code.

Aging panels produce their own group. Federal Pacific and specific Zinsco panels have actually earned their online reputations. Breakers that do not reliably journey are not a trait. They are a threat. Updating a panel can feel like optional surgical treatment till you take a look at the test data. If your panel gets on among the recognized problem checklists, ask a Garland electrician for alternatives, and get it priced before an insurance provider does it for you after a claim.

We likewise see attic room entwines with tape joints from old cable TV or DIY illumination runs. Warmth in a North Texas attic speeds up insulation failure. Those connections belong in joint boxes with covers and pressure alleviations. A few hours of restorative job can prevent a phone call to the fire department on a gusty night.

The EV battery charger and generator wave has arrived, and both benefit from planning
The last three years brought a flooding of EVs and a constant uptick in standby generators. Both live at the crossway of energy sychronisation, load management, and home owner expectations.

EV circuits look easy up until you add them to a panel already at 80 percent throughout summer. A sharp property electrician in Garland runs a load computation, inquires about future devices, and uses load-shedding gadgets when required. Sometimes a 60 amp circuit to a separated garage ends up being extra pricey than expected because of trenching, slab crossings, or a complete panel. Much better to learn that before you buy the car.

Generators welcome their very own risks. Backfeeding a home with a dryer electrical outlet dangers linemen's lives and spaces insurance. Appropriate transfer equipment, clear labeling, and grounding are not optional. In Garland, we coordinate with the city and utility to make sure the solution configuration is right. If gas capability is limited, we involve an accredited plumbing professional for sizing. The right set up runs silently and safely when you require it most.
